                    The perch on the Ocean side of the jetty are FAT! if you ever see birds diving on the ocean side cast right into the flock.. theyll move and you cant get your gear to the bottom before you're hooked.

                          I'm going to try saltwater fly fishing for cutthroat near where I live around gig harbor
                          It's supposed to be the best fishery of its type in the world, you can sight cast for fish, and the peak time Is in the summer
